Prosciutto, Feta & Cherry Tomato Garden Salad

A quick and refreshing Mediterranean Prosciutto, Feta & Cherry Tomato Garden Salad made with crisp mixed greens, salty prosciutto, creamy feta cheese, and juicy cherry tomatoes, all tossed in a bright homemade lemon vinaigrette dressing. Ingredients
  

Salad

  • 4 cups mixed greens spring mix, arugula, baby spinach
  • 6 Prosciutto slices or more torn into pieces
  • ½ cup Feta cheese crumbled
  • 1 cup Cherry tomatoes halved
  • Freshly cracked black pepper
  • Optional: shaved parmesan or extra feta

Simple Lemon Vinaigrette

  • 3 tbsp Olive oil
  • 1 tbsp fresh lemon juice
  • 1 tsp honey optional
  • Salt & pepper to taste

Instructions
 

  • Prepare the greens
    Add mixed greens to a large bowl.
  • Add toppings
    Scatter cherry tomatoes, feta crumbles, olives, and torn prosciutto over the greens.
  • Make dressing
    Whisk olive oil, lemon juice, honey, salt, and pepper.
  • Toss lightly
    Drizzle dressing over the salad and gently toss.
  • Finish & serve
    Top with fresh cracked pepper and extra feta if desired.

Notes

  • This Mediterranean Prosciutto Salad recipe is best served fresh to enjoy the crisp texture of the greens and the creamy feta cheese.
  • Use high-quality extra virgin olive oil for the most flavorful and authentic homemade lemon vinaigrette dressing.
  • For the best results, tear prosciutto instead of chopping it to maintain a soft, delicate texture in this gourmet salad recipe.
  • Ripe, sweet cherry tomatoes enhance the natural freshness and balance the salty prosciutto and feta.
  • Add the dressing just before serving to keep this fresh garden salad recipe crisp and vibrant.
  • This recipe works beautifully as a healthy lunch salad, low-carb dinner, or Mediterranean side dish.
  • For extra flavor depth, let the dressing sit for 5–10 minutes before tossing to allow the ingredients to blend.
